Illini offer Cali safety
Jonah Puls
Recruiting contributor

2019 prospect Ralen Goforth of Bellflower (Calif.) St. John Bosco may still be in the beginning stages of his recruiting process, but he has already accumulated a profound list of offers from schools such as Arizona State, Nebraska, TCU, UCLA, USC, and Washington, among others.

The Illini are one of the most recent schools to offer the 6-foot-2, 215-pound safety, as assistant coach Hardy Nickerson delivered the news over a phone call just last week.

"I was on my way to a workout with one of my football coaches and he told me that Coach Nickerson from the University of Illinois wanted to speak with me and to give him a call,” Goforth said. “So, I called him and we had a great conservation, and he told me the scheme they run and that my skill set would fit that perfectly. And after a great talk, he then offered me a scholarship.”
